Kubernetes
Kubernetes
Free 1 RatingKubernetes (K8s) is a powerful open-source platform designed to automate the deployment, scaling, and management of applications that are containerized. By organizing containers into manageable groups, it simplifies the processes of application management and discovery. Drawing from over 15 years of experience in handling production workloads at Google, Kubernetes also incorporates the best practices and innovative ideas from the wider community. Built on the same foundational principles that enable Google to efficiently manage billions of containers weekly, it allows for scaling without necessitating an increase in operational personnel. Whether you are developing locally or operating a large-scale enterprise, Kubernetes adapts to your needs, providing reliable and seamless application delivery regardless of complexity. Moreover, being open-source, Kubernetes offers the flexibility to leverage on-premises, hybrid, or public cloud environments, facilitating easy migration of workloads to the most suitable infrastructure. Phind serves as an innovative search engine tailored specifically for developers, featuring support for progressive web applications. Users can easily integrate Phind into their devices by adding it to their home screens, enabling a native app experience; for iOS, simply navigate to phind.com in Safari, tap the share button, and select "add to home screen," while for Android users, they should tap the menu button in Chrome followed by "add to home screen." Additionally, users have the ability to manipulate search result rankings by incorporating specific domain names and keywords; by pasting the URL of a site they wish to adjust, Phind will extract the domain and include it in the user's list, or they can manually input a domain or keyword as needed. If you set a rule with the keyword ".rs," it will automatically apply to all domains ending with ".rs," such as rustup.rs, releases.rs, cxx.rs, and cheats.rs. Our goal is to create a search experience that is as fluid and insightful as conversing with a knowledgeable friend. Phind, which was previously known as Hello, provides straightforward answers to users' inquiries, ensuring it is optimized for developers and technical queries alike. NVIDIA virtual GPU
NVIDIA
NVIDIA's virtual GPU (vGPU) software delivers high-performance GPU capabilities essential for various tasks, including graphics-intensive virtual workstations and advanced data science applications, allowing IT teams to harness the advantages of virtualization alongside the robust performance provided by NVIDIA GPUs for contemporary workloads. This software is installed on a physical GPU within a cloud or enterprise data center server, effectively creating virtual GPUs that can be distributed across numerous virtual machines, permitting access from any device at any location. The performance achieved is remarkably similar to that of a bare metal setup, ensuring a seamless user experience. Additionally, it utilizes standard data center management tools, facilitating processes like live migration, and enables the provisioning of GPU resources through fractional or multi-GPU virtual machine instances.
